Crash Cart Components

In the fast-paced world of data centers, a crash cart is an indispensable tool for rapid troubleshooting and repair. It’s a portable toolkit packed with essential tools and equipment designed to diagnose and resolve hardware or software issues quickly and efficiently.

The contents of a crash cart vary depending on the specific needs of the data center, but some common components include:

Diagnostic Tools

These tools are used to identify and diagnose hardware or software problems.

  • Multimeter:Measures voltage, current, and resistance.
  • Oscilloscope:Analyzes electrical signals.
  • Network analyzer:Tests network connectivity and performance.
  • Protocol analyzer:Captures and analyzes network traffic.

Repair Tools

These tools are used to fix hardware or software problems.

  • Screwdrivers:For removing and replacing screws.
  • Wrenches:For tightening and loosening bolts and nuts.
  • Pliers:For gripping and cutting wires.
  • Soldering iron:For repairing electrical connections.

Consumables

These items are used to support the repair process.

  • Electrical tape:For insulating wires.
  • Zip ties:For bundling wires.
  • Spare parts:Such as cables, connectors, and fuses.

Other Essential Items

These items are not directly related to repair but are essential for the operation of the crash cart.

  • Flashlight:For illuminating dark areas.
  • First-aid kit:For minor injuries.
  • Documentation:Such as manuals and troubleshooting guides.

Crash Cart Deployment and Usage: Data Centre Crash Cart

In the event of a data center emergency, a crash cart is a crucial tool for diagnosing and resolving issues. It contains a comprehensive set of tools and equipment specifically designed for data center troubleshooting.

The deployment and usage of a crash cart involve a coordinated effort among various personnel with specific roles and responsibilities. Understanding these roles and the step-by-step process for using the crash cart is essential for effective emergency response.

Personnel Roles and Responsibilities, Data centre crash cart

  • Incident Commander:Oversees the overall response and coordinates resources.
  • Technical Lead:Responsible for diagnosing and resolving technical issues using the crash cart.
  • Support Staff:Assists the technical lead with equipment setup, documentation, and other tasks.

Crash Cart Deployment and Usage Procedure

  1. Activate Emergency Response:Notify the incident commander and technical lead.
  2. Retrieve Crash Cart:Obtain the crash cart from its designated storage location.
  3. Set Up Crash Cart:Connect necessary equipment, such as a laptop, network analyzer, and power tools.
  4. Diagnose Issue:Use the crash cart tools to identify the source of the problem.
  5. Resolve Issue:Implement appropriate troubleshooting steps to resolve the issue.
  6. Document Actions:Record all troubleshooting steps and actions taken.
  7. Report Findings:Inform the incident commander of the issue and resolution.

Crash Cart Maintenance and Management

Data centre crash cart

Maintaining and managing the data center crash cart is crucial for ensuring its readiness and effectiveness. Regular testing, calibration, and updates are essential to guarantee the cart’s functionality and reliability.

To ensure the crash cart’s optimal performance, it’s recommended to follow a structured maintenance schedule. This includes:

Testing

  • Perform regular tests on all equipment, including power supplies, cables, and tools, to verify their functionality.
  • Conduct simulation exercises to test the cart’s deployment and usage procedures.

Calibration

  • Calibrate measuring and diagnostic tools regularly to ensure accurate readings.
  • Check the accuracy of equipment such as voltmeters, ammeters, and temperature gauges.

Updates

  • Stay up-to-date with software and firmware updates for all devices and tools in the crash cart.
  • Review and incorporate industry best practices and advancements into the crash cart’s equipment and procedures.

Best Practices for Storage, Handling, and Security

  • Store the crash cart in a secure, easily accessible location with controlled temperature and humidity.
  • Handle the cart with care, avoiding any damage to equipment or components.
  • Limit access to the crash cart to authorized personnel only, ensuring proper accountability and security.
  • Keep a detailed inventory of all items in the crash cart, regularly verifying its completeness.
